Questions about Skunky

  • What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?

    Domestic Short Hair cats like Skunky thrive in a loving and stimulating environment. They adapt well to various living situations, from apartments to houses, as long as they receive plenty of attention and playtime.

  • How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?

    Cats like Skunky enjoy having access to a safe outdoor space where they can explore and play, but they are perfectly content living indoors as well, provided they have engaging toys and activities.

  •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?

    Domestic Short Hair cats, including Skunky, are generally suitable for homes with children. Their friendly disposition allows them to adapt well to family life.
